[3] EXTERNAL VIEW AND INTERNAL STRUCTURE
1. Identification of each section and functions
A. External view
No.
Name
Function/Operation
1
Automatic document feeder
This automatically feeds and scans multiple originals. 
Both sides of 2-sided originals can be automatically scanned.
2
Front cover
Open this cover to switch the main power switch to "On" or "Off" or to replace a toner cartridge.
3
Output tray (center tray)
Output is delivered to this tray.
4
Operation panel
This is used to select functions and enter the number of copies.
5
Exit tray unit (right exit tray)
When installed, output can be delivered to this tray.
6
Bypass tray
Use this tray to feed paper manually.
When loading a large sheet of paper, be sure to pull out the bypass tray extension.
7
Finisher
This can be used to staple output. A punch module can also be installed to punch holes in output.
8
USB connector (A type)
Supports USB 2.0 (Hi-Speed).
This is used to connect a USB device such as USB memory to the machine.
For the USB cable, use a shielded cable.
9
Tray 1
Paper holding cassette.
10
Tray 2 (when a paper feed tray is installed or when 
the Stand/500&2000 sheet paper drawer is installed)
Paper holding cassette
11
Tray 3 (when a paper feed tray is installed or when 
the Stand/500&2000 sheet paper drawer is installed)
Paper holding cassette.
12
Tray 4 (when a paper feed tray is installed or when 
the Stand/500&2000 sheet paper drawer is installed)
Paper holding cassette.
13
Tray 5 (when a large capacity tray is installed)
Large capacity paper holding tray.
14
Saddle stitch finisher
This can be used to staple output. The saddle stitch function for folding and stapling output and the fold 
function for folding output in half are also available. 
A punch module can also be installed to punch holes in output.
15
Keyboard
This is a keyboard that is incorporated into the machine. When not used, it can be stored under the 
operation panel.
16
Paper pass unit
Transports paper to the finisher.
